The free Maktun and Coinoscope apps on my iPhone identify this as an aluminum one paisa from Nepal, Mahendra (1966-1971), KM#748.
To decipher the exact date you could use the Creounity site

http://creounity.com/apps/time_mach....php&lang=en

(I get 1969). The second photo is upside down.
